Lefthook

A Git hooks manager for Node.js, Ruby, Python and many other types of projects.

  • Fast. It is written in Go. Can run commands in parallel.
  • Powerful. It allows to control execution and files you pass to your commands.
  • Simple. It is single dependency-free binary which can work in any environment.

Install

With Go (>= 1.25):

go install github.com/evilmartians/lefthook/v2@v2.1.0
  • or as a go tool
go get -tool github.com/evilmartians/lefthook

With NPM:

npm install lefthook --save-dev

For Ruby:

gem install lefthook

For Python:

pipx install lefthook

Usage

Configure your hooks, install them once and forget about it: rely on the magic underneath.

TL;DR
# Configure your hooks
vim lefthook.yml

# Install them to the git project
lefthook install

# Enjoy your work with git
git add -A && git commit -m '...'

Why Lefthook

  • Parallel execution

Gives you more speed. docs

pre-push:
  parallel: true
  • Flexible list of files

If you want your own list. Custom and prebuilt examples.

pre-commit:
  jobs:
    - name: lint frontend
      run: yarn eslint {staged_files}

    - name: lint backend
      run: bundle exec rubocop --force-exclusion {all_files}

    - name: stylelint frontend
      files: git diff --name-only HEAD @{push}
      run: yarn stylelint {files}
  • Glob and regexp filters

If you want to filter list of files. You could find more glob pattern examples here.

pre-commit:
  jobs:
    - name: lint backend
      glob: "*.rb" # glob filter
      exclude:
        - "*/application.rb"
        - "*/routes.rb"
      run: bundle exec rubocop --force-exclusion {all_files}
  • Execute in sub-directory

If you want to execute the commands in a relative path

pre-commit:
  jobs:
    - name: lint backend
      root: "api/" # Careful to have only trailing slash
      glob: "*.rb" # glob filter
      run: bundle exec rubocop {all_files}
  • Run scripts

If oneline commands are not enough, you can execute files. docs

commit-msg:
  jobs:
    - script: "template_checker"
      runner: bash
  • Tags

If you want to control a group of commands. docs

pre-push:
  jobs:
    - name: audit packages
      tags:
        - frontend
        - linters
      run: yarn lint

    - name: audit gems
      tags:
        - backend
        - security
      run: bundle audit
  • Support Docker

If you are in the Docker environment. docs

pre-commit:
  jobs:
    - script: "good_job.js"
      runner: docker run -it --rm <container_id_or_name> {cmd}
  • Local config

If you are a frontend/backend developer and want to skip unnecessary commands or override something in Docker. docs

# lefthook-local.yml
pre-push:
  exclude_tags:
    - frontend
  jobs:
    - name: audit packages
      skip: true
  • Direct control

If you want to run hooks group directly.

$ lefthook run pre-commit
  • Your own tasks

If you want to run specific group of commands directly.

fixer:
  jobs:
    - run: bundle exec rubocop --force-exclusion --safe-auto-correct {staged_files}
    - run: yarn eslint --fix {staged_files}
$ lefthook run fixer
  • Control output

You can control what lefthook prints with output option.

output:
  - execution
  - failure
